Robert MARKS 1745–1829 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 3 Oct 1745

Birth Location: West Buckland, Somerset, England

Death Date: 22 Mar 1829

Death Location: West Buckland, Somerset, England

Father: Thomas Marks

Mother: Grace Hurley

Spouse(s): Betty Surfill

Children(s): Robert Marks

Robert MARKS was born in 1745 in West Buckland, Somerset, England, the child of Thomas Marks And Grace Hurley. Robert MARKS married Betty Surfill, and had children including Robert Marks. Robert MARKS passed away in 1829 in West Buckland, Somerset, England.
